Popular actress and comedienne, Chioma Omeruah, better known as Chigul, has sorrowfully announced the death of her uncle, fondly called Uncle Nduka.
In her post, the actress shared a lovely picture taken with the deceased before the unfortunate incident.

Source: Instagram
According to Chigul, who was once dragged online over her appearance on Who Wants to Be a Millionaire, she admitted that she was not okay, describing the loss as something that does not make sense to her.
She added that the death of Uncle Nduka would never make sense, but she still believes God remains God, even in her pain.

The comedienne further said that somehow she would have to live with the loss because God is still on the throne.
Chigul speaks about her grief

Source: Instagram
Chigul noted that there is no one left to call her “IJ” again, as her late uncle was the only one who did. She confessed that the reality was very hard for her, wishing she could call him but knowing she never could again.
Still in mourning, she explained that all she now has of Uncle Nduka are memories and thoughts.
She emotionally expressed that she longed for someone to stress her the way her uncle used to, but no one else could.
Comedian Chigul promised to always hold space for her uncle, thanking him for loving her and being a covering in her life.
She ended on a light note, warning him not to stress the angels in heaven the way he used to stress her.

Chigul slams young men trying to woo her
Meanwhile, Chigul took to social media to call out the young men coming to her on Instagram to ask her out.
She warned them to stay away from her. According to her, the men coming to her should go back to their online classes instead of trying to woo her.
She joked that some of them would call her baby instead of addressing her as mummy.
